首页> 外国专利> Automatic conversion from MPI source code program to MPI thread-based program

Automatic conversion from MPI source code program to MPI thread-based program

机译:自动从MPI源代码程序转换为基于MPI线程的程序

摘要

PROBLEM TO BE SOLVED: To provide a method for automatically converting an MPI (Message Passing Infrastructure) source code program into an MPI thread-based program.;SOLUTION: In this method, in response to input of an MPI source code program and a command, a converter declares a global variable as a thread private variable to create a first private variable 212 for a first thread 210 and a second private variable 222 for a second thread 220. A library is identified to support converting processes to threads during execution of the MPI thread-based program. The identified library is used to build an executable version of the MPI thread-based program. A code in the identified library identifies instantiation of a new process when the MPI thread-based program is executing, and in response, causes a corresponding thread for the MPI thread-based program to be instantiated.;COPYRIGHT: (C)2011,JPO&INPIT
机译:解决的问题:提供一种自动将MPI(消息传递基础结构)源代码程序转换为基于MPI线程的程序的方法。解决方案:在这种方法中,响应于MPI源代码程序和命令的输入,转换器将全局变量声明为线程私有变量,以为第一线程210创建第一私有变量212,为第二线程220创建第二私有变量222。识别出一个库以支持在执行线程期间将进程转换为线程基于MPI线程的程序。标识的库用于构建基于MPI线程的程序的可执行版本。标识的库中的代码在执行基于MPI线程的程序时标识新进程的实例,作为响应,该实例使基于MPI线程的程序的相应线程实例化。;版权所有:(C)2011,JPO&INPIT

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号